Langklick, bzw. langes Tippen auf einen Beobachtungspunkt im Kartenfenster erfasst einen Punkt, vergibt einen automatischen Namen für den Punkt aus Benutzername und Zeitstempel und öffnet, wenn im Projekt nur 1 Formular zugeordnet ist dieses zur direkten Datenerfassung, andernfalls den Dialog zur Formularauswahl.
Werden in Formularen Zahlenfelder eingesetzt wird die Mobile- Eingabe durch das Anzeigen der Zahlentastatur vereinfacht.
Textfelder im BioDivCollector können mit speziellen Funktionen automatisch ausgefüllt werden. Sobald der Standardtext im Textfeld einem unten beschriebenen Muster entspricht, wird der Inhalt automatisch im System ersetzt.
Folgende Spezialfunktion stehen aktuell (v1.2) zur Verfügung:
now(): Sobald in ein Textfeld der Inhalt now() eingetragen wird, so wird das aktuelle Datum in Form von tt.mm.jjjj eingefüllt.
userfullname(): Mit userfullname() wird der Inhalt des Textfelds mit dem Vorname + Nachname ersetzt.
userid(): Der Inhalt des Textfeldes wird mit dem Benutzername des Erfassers ersetzt.
length(): Dadurch wir die Länge einer Linie in m 2 eingesetzt.
area(): Bei Polygonen wird die Fläche in m3 2 eingesetzt.
coordinates(): Speichert die aktuellen GPS Koordinate des Mobilgerätes beim Erfassen eines Punktes
...
Sobald eine neue Beobachtung erstellt wird, werden die Felder automatisch ausgefüllt. Sie können jedoch vom Benutzer überschrieben werden. Damit dies verhindert werden kann bzw. damit die Felder bei jeder Bearbeitung neu ausgefüllt werden besteht die Möglichkeit ein = beim Standardwert voran zusetzen. Setzt man zum Beispiel den Standardwert auf =now() dann wird bei jedem Bearbeiten das Datum neu gesetzt. So erhält man das letzte Bearbeitungsdatum der Beobachtung.